What is Bibimbap? Bibimbap simply translates to - mixed rice with meat and assorted vegetables. This Korean dish is packed with vegetables and protein. It's a great dish to cook when you need to use up some leftover veggies and you can always switch out the beef for tofu if you would like a vegetarian option.
Method
- Soak rice for 4-24hrs or rinse until water runs clear.
- Marinade beef in minced garlic, ginger, spring onion, tamari and 1 tbsp sesame oil for at least 4 hrs before cooking.
- Quickly pan-fry beef for 2-5 minutes.
- Thinly slice or julienne the carrot.
- Thinly slice zucchini and saute until soft in a little sesame oil, repeat this with the asian greens and bean sprouts.
- Cook rice with absorption method or using rice cooker. Once cooked add in rice vinegar and sesame oil.
- Fry egg in pan.
- Place rice in bottom of bowl. Place the satued vegetables and beef around the bowl. Add egg and gochujang on top with a sprinkle of sesame seeds. Mix together and enjoy!
